> -static irqreturn_t mvebu_pcie_irq_handler(int irq, void *arg)
> +static irqreturn_t mvebu_pcie_error_irq_handler(int irq, void *arg)
> +{
> +	struct mvebu_pcie_port *port = arg;
> +	struct device *dev = &port->pcie->pdev->dev;
> +	u32 cause, unmask, status;
> +
> +	cause = mvebu_readl(port, PCIE_INT_CAUSE_OFF);
> +	unmask = mvebu_readl(port, PCIE_INT_UNMASK_OFF);
> +	status = cause & unmask;
> +
> +	/* "error" interrupt handler does not process INTX interrupts */
> +	status &= ~(PCIE_INT_INTX(0) | PCIE_INT_INTX(1) |
> +		    PCIE_INT_INTX(2) | PCIE_INT_INTX(3));

Just for my understanding...

There are two interrupts, but the status information what those
interrupts actually mean are all packed into one register? I assume
reading the clause register does not clear set bits? Otherwise there
would be a race condition. Are these actually level interrupts, and in
order to clear them you need to poke some other register?
